Weight and Swing Speed Considerations

Weight is a crucial factor in determining the performance of a golf shaft. The Ping Alta Quick 35 weighs approximately 35 grams, making it one of the lightest options available. This lightweight design helps golfers generate faster swing speeds with minimal effort. Players with slower swings may benefit from its easy-to-swing nature.

The Ping Alta Quick 45, on the other hand, weighs around 45 grams. This added weight provides slightly more stability throughout the swing. Golfers who prefer a bit more control and balance may find this option more appealing. The extra grams can also contribute to improved tempo and rhythm.

A lighter shaft generally allows for increased clubhead speed. This can lead to greater distance, especially for players with moderate swing speeds. Golfers seeking effortless power may lean towards the Ping Alta Quick 35.

In contrast, a slightly heavier shaft can enhance overall shot consistency. The Ping Alta Quick 45 may be better suited for those looking for a balance between speed and stability. This makes it a great choice for golfers who want to refine accuracy without sacrificing performance.

Flex and Feel

Flex impacts how a shaft responds during the swing. The Ping Alta Quick 35 offers a softer flex, making it ideal for smooth tempo players. It helps create more whip effect, adding extra distance and launch. This can be beneficial for golfers who struggle with generating power.

The Ping Alta Quick 45 provides a slightly firmer flex. This added firmness offers a more controlled feel, helping with shot dispersion. Players who prefer stability over extra flex may find it more suitable. The stiffer profile ensures a balanced transition from backswing to follow-through.

Feel is another important aspect when selecting a shaft. The Ping Alta Quick 35 gives a lightweight sensation that makes swinging effortless. Golfers who enjoy a fluid and easy tempo will appreciate its design. The smooth energy transfer also enhances comfort during impact.

For those who prioritize control, the Ping Alta Quick 45 provides a more stable feel. The extra weight allows for greater feedback, which can help refine ball striking. This makes it an excellent option for golfers who want a firmer yet responsive shaft.

Launch and Trajectory

The Ping Alta Quick 35 is designed to promote a higher launch. The lightweight structure helps lift the ball more easily off the clubface. This feature is useful for players who struggle with achieving sufficient height. A higher trajectory can also improve carry distance.

The Ping Alta Quick 45, while still promoting good launch, offers a slightly lower flight. The added weight contributes to a more penetrating trajectory. This can be beneficial for golfers who prefer a controlled ball flight. The balance between launch and spin enhances overall shot shaping.

Higher launch shafts like the Ping Alta Quick 35 help with maximizing distance. Golfers with slower swings often see an improvement in their carry numbers. The increased launch also assists in landing softly on greens.

A more controlled trajectory, like that of the Ping Alta Quick 45, suits players looking for accuracy. The shaft’s design minimizes excessive ballooning in windy conditions. This ensures more predictable ball flights for various course scenarios.

Who Should Choose the Ping Alta Quick 35?

Golfers with moderate to slower swing speeds will benefit the most from this shaft. The lightweight construction makes it easier to generate speed. Players who struggle with launching the ball may find it particularly useful. The higher trajectory ensures optimal carry distance.

Those who prefer a soft and whippy feel will enjoy the Ping Alta Quick 35. The flex allows for additional energy transfer, enhancing overall shot performance. This feature is ideal for golfers who rely on tempo rather than sheer power. A smooth transition throughout the swing promotes consistency.

Senior players or those recovering from injuries may find the lighter weight appealing. The effortless nature of the shaft helps reduce fatigue during long rounds. Swinging with less strain allows for greater endurance on the course. This makes it a great choice for comfort-focused golfers.

Beginners who want an easy-to-use shaft may also benefit. The lightweight design promotes confidence in ball striking. Golfers who need assistance in maximizing launch and distance should consider this option.

Who Should Choose the Ping Alta Quick 45?

Players seeking a balance between weight and control may prefer this shaft. The added grams provide extra stability, ensuring a more controlled swing. Golfers who struggle with accuracy may benefit from its firmer feel. This design helps keep shots on target.

Those who prioritize a more penetrating ball flight will appreciate the Ping Alta Quick 45. The slightly heavier profile reduces excessive spin. This leads to a more predictable shot shape, ideal for windy conditions. Lower trajectory provides additional versatility.

Golfers with moderate to fast swing speeds may find this shaft more effective. The added weight helps improve consistency in ball striking. Players who want a more structured feel will appreciate its design. It offers a blend of stability and responsiveness.

Advanced players looking for enhanced shot control should consider this shaft. The firmer flex provides feedback on every shot. This allows for better precision when shaping shots. It suits golfers who focus on both distance and accuracy.
